Why are the negative numbers included?

When you multiply two negative numbers together, you get a positive number. That means both the positive and negative numbers are factors of 434,422,403.

Example:
1 x 434,422,403 = 434,422,403
and
-1 x -434,422,403 = 434,422,403
Notice both answers equal 434,422,403
